This resource book provides good practices, innovative techniques and recommendations recognized by an international team of experts. It discusses the legal background of combating child trafficking; and discusses good practices on age assessment and identification of the child; investigative methods; interviewing techniques; and cooperation between law enforcement authorities and NGOs/social service providers. The book is from a project entitled “Comprehensive Training for Law Enforcement Authorities Responsible for Trafficking in Children/Minors” implemented by the International Organization for Migration (IOM) in Vienna.
